For a sound that lives on the harder edge of the techno spectrum, you'll want to explore Hard Techno and Industrial. These genres often feature four-on-the-floor beats with heavily distorted, pounding kicks and an unrelenting drive. The sound is less about melody and more about creating a powerful, industrial atmosphere.
